Subject: [RFC PATCH 1/4] mm: move tlb_table_flush to tlb_flush_mmu_free

There is no need to call this from tlb_flush_mmu_tlbonly, it
logically belongs with tlb_flush_mmu_free. This allows some
code consolidation with a subsequent fix.
Signed-off-by: Nicholas Piggin <npiggin@gmail.com>
---
mm/memory.c | 6 +++---
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
diff --git a/mm/memory.c b/mm/memory.c
index 7206a634270b..bc053d5e9d41 100644
--- a/mm/memory.c
+++ b/mm/memory.c
@@ -245,9 +245,6 @@ static void tlb_flush_mmu_tlbonly(struct mmu_gather *tlb)
tlb_flush(tlb);
mmu_notifier_invalidate_range(tlb->mm, tlb->start, tlb->end);
-#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_RCU_TABLE_FREE
- tlb_table_flush(tlb);
-#endif
__tlb_reset_range(tlb);
}
@@ -255,6 +252,9 @@ static void tlb_flush_mmu_free(struct mmu_gather *tlb)
{
struct mmu_gather_batch *batch;
+#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_RCU_TABLE_FREE
+ tlb_table_flush(tlb);
+#endif
for (batch = &tlb->local; batch && batch->nr; batch = batch->next) {
free_pages_and_swap_cache(batch->pages, batch->nr);
batch->nr = 0;
